Strona: [  << <   1   > >>  ]  z  1     
Autor Temat: Split
anonim




Typ: Nie zarejestrowany
Split

witam ma następujacy problem przy wywołaniu fukncji

Dim Data As String
Text1.Text = Split(Data, "+"(0)
Text2.Text = Split(Data, "+"(1)

wyskakuje mi błąd o numerku "9"

subscript out of range

nie mam pojęcia o co chodzi ?
moze ktoś z Was zna odpowiedź ?

25-09-2004 20:46
  
bisiek




Typ: neutral
Postów: 487
Zarejestrowany: Jul 2003

Czy data jest puste? Jeżeli tak to nie tworzy tablicy.


_____________________________________________
www.mob.abc.pl - moja strona o VB

25-09-2004 22:36
Pokaż profil bisiek  Wyślij email do bisiek   Odwiedź stronę bisiek       3380672
anonim




Typ: Nie zarejestrowany

właśnie w tym problem że zmienna data tuz przed wywołaniem funkcji dostaje zawartosc :/

26-09-2004 19:11
  
bisiek




Typ: neutral
Postów: 487
Zarejestrowany: Jul 2003

A czy w zmiennej jest tyle "+" ile trzeba?


_____________________________________________
www.mob.abc.pl - moja strona o VB

26-09-2004 20:35
Pokaż profil bisiek  Wyślij email do bisiek   Odwiedź stronę bisiek       3380672
anonim




Typ: Nie zarejestrowany

hmm

zawartosć zmiennej wygląda tak:

jakiśtekst & "+" & jakiśtekst

26-09-2004 22:33
  
anonim




Typ: Nie zarejestrowany

pomyłka wyglad atak:

jakiś tekst+jakis tekst

26-09-2004 22:35
  
marcin_an
Forumowicz




Typ: neutral
Postów: 1265
Zarejestrowany: Mar 2004

Sprawdziłem u siebie i działa bez problemu...

Przychodzą mi do głowy takie pomysły:
1) Spróbuj zmienić nazwę zmiennej z Data na coś innego. Może nazwa zmiennej z czymś koliduje i pobierane jest nie to, co trzeba.
2) Spróbuj zamiast od razu przypisywać do textboxów, najpierw przypisać do tablicy, a potem elementy tablicy do textboxów. Co prawda taka składnia wydaje się prawidłowa i działa, ale tak szczerze mówiąc... pierwszy raz się z nią spotykam.
3) Sprawedź, czy zmienna Data rzeczywiscie dostaje wartość. Najlepiej idź krok po kroku (F8) i sprawdzaj jej zawartość, albo tuż przed Splitem daj Debug.Print Data.


_____________________________________________
Jedzonko dla Google'a:
Forum na temat Visual Basic, C, C++, Pascal, Programowanie, API, PHP, VBA, VB.NET, QBasic, VBScript, Komputery
Moja strona o wszystkim

26-09-2004 23:15
Pokaż profil marcin_an  Wyślij email do marcin_an   Odwiedź stronę marcin_an  
Wszystkich odpowiedzi: 6 :: Maxymalnie na stronę: 20
Strona: [  << <   1   > >>  ]  z  1